Harry Potter Advent Calendar - Day 22

Posted by ,

Three days remain in 75981 Harry Potter Advent Calendar and I am hoping that every unrevealed item will prove as appealing as those which have emerged thus far.

Let's open the door and find out...

Harry Potter and Ron Weasley have both appeared already so Hermione Granger's arrival was inevitable! This minifigure looks absolutely marvellous, featuring an outstanding hair component that returns from 75948 Hogwarts Clock Tower. Such intricate detail is unrivalled and reflects the onscreen character's hairstyle perfectly. A hole to accommodate an accessory is included on top but no hair accessories are provided.

Hermione's pink dress appears similarly authentic, featuring layers of pink and magenta fabric which correspond with the source material. I am especially pleased with the elegant ruffles that continue onto the 1x2 brick which forms the lower section of Hermione's dress, ensuring that all six minifigures available with this Advent Calendar are exactly the same height.

The double-sided head incorporates smiling and angry expressions which might typically seem unsuitable for the Yule Ball, although these designs reflect Hermione's emotions as the evening continues. A dark tan wand is supplied, along with a separate sprue which increases the total to three spares.

Overall - 4.5 - Despite appearing once before, this Hermione Granger minifigure looks incredible and I welcome her return!

By in United States,

@Darth_TNT:
It would be nice if they printed both the brick and plate on both sides (or a new midi skirt with print on four sides). But I ran the numbers and figured out that there are already 100 paint applications just on these six minifigs, a lot of which is unique to this set. Then there are eight more prints (five on just the Yule Ball poster), and the egg is painted gold. It would take at least another dozen print applications to give just the four bricks a two-sided print.

@Rob42:
Last year you got one sprue per minifig in the HPAC, but this year you get two sprues (four wands) per minifig, which is enough that you can turn the sands into a second, lame, advent calendar).
